    The town of Winthrop is one of the many unique small out of the way places that has a fun character harkening back to the early days of this nation. The Town has maintained its small western town identity that can take visitors back to a more simple way of life. Even though it is a bit on the touristy side, it is worth the visit. Most impressive is the mountain range that Winthrop is a gateway to. The North Cascades Highway winds through some of the most awe inspiring landscapes in the USA with its rock formations, lakes, rivers, and dams not to mention the mind numbing hiking trailheads all along the road. My wife and I went for the hikes and were not disappointed. With Winthrop as our base, we could have spent a week hiking.

    Winthrop is a real "western." town. We went to the Old School house brewery for a great hamburger and beer made at this facility. Winthrop is right on the road to perhaps the most beautiful mountains in Washington. For motorcycle riders, hiway 20 over Washington Pass to Winthrop is the number one rated ride in the state.
